  • Patent number: 5388868
    Abstract: Invention is directed to a circular coupling for joining a first tubular member to a second member, where the second member may be a tubular member larger than the first, or a manhole. Specifically, the first end of the coupling is adapted to encircle the first tubular member and a second end thereof is adapted to be received within a complementary opening in the second member. The coupling comprises an elongated open ended tubular joint member formed of a relatively rigid sheet-like member or members, where opposing sheet ends overlap such that the end portions lie contiguous with each other. Within the joint member is a continuous sleeve formed of an elastomeric material contiguous with the inner surface of the tubular joint member and extending from the first end toward and wrapped around the second end.

  • Patent number: 5333916
    Abstract: This invention preferably relates to an externally applied coupling system providing thrust restraint for a pair of axially aligned tubular members. The coupling system comprises a hydraulically/pneumatically inflatable, elastomeric sealing gasket adapted to encircle and apply pressure to the wall of the tubular members, where the sealing gasket includes means for inflating same, and a support member. The support member is defined by a pair of curved legs joined by a web portion along one end of each curved leg to reveal a U-shaped channel member. The free end of each curved leg cooperates with one of the tubular members to provide thrust restraint thereto, and further, the support member is adapted to overlie the sealing gasket so as to confine the compressive pressure from the sealing gasket against predefined annular portions of the tubular members.

  • Patent number: 5224741
    Abstract: This invention is directed to an internal expansion coupling system offering improved thrust restraint when joined to a pair of tubular members, preferably plastic, aligned in end-to-end relationship. The system comprises an elongated open ended tubular joint member formed from at least one, relatively rigid, rectangular sheet-like member, where each sheet-like member is defined by a pair of opposing sheet ends and a pair of opposing sheet sides, and a pair of sheet ends overlap such that the end portions thereof lie in close proximity to each other. The joint member is provided with a continuous circumferential gasket sealing sleeve formed of an elastomeric material and overlapping each said sheet side about the open end of the tubular joint member, where said gasket sealing sleeve is adapted to lie adjacent to and be compressed against the inside wall of said tubular member. Further, a member accessible externally thereof, as known in the art, is provided for expanding the tubular joint member.

  • Patent number: 5201550
    Abstract: This invention is directed to the combination of a pair of aligned tubular members joined in end-to-end relationship by an internal expansion coupling device, where such coupling device offers thrust restraint to the combination. Each of the tubular members is characterized by the end thereof having one or more circumferentially disposed recesses about its wall. The coupling device, which cooperates with said recesses comprises an elongated open ended tubular joint member formed from at least one relatively rigid, rectangular sheet-like member, where said member is defined by a pair of opposing sheet ends with a pair of opposing sheet sides. The sheet ends thereof overlap such that the end portions lie contiguous with each other.

  • Patent number: 5092633
    Abstract: An internal expansion coupling member for use in joining a pair of aligned tubular members in end-to-end relationship, where said tubular members are characterized by an essentially uniform diameter and are adapted to transmit a medium under pressure. The coupling member comprises an internal expansion coupling device formed of an elongated open ended tubular joint member consisting of a relatively rigid sheet-like member, where the sheet ends overlap such that the end portions lie essentially contiguous with each other. Preferably a compressive seal member is provided between the end portions. About the circumference of the joint member, means, such as an annular groove, is provided to position and retain an O-ring type member thereabout. At least one compressible and flexible O-ring type member, formed of a high temperature resistant material, is secured thereabout by said means.

  • Patent number: 4997212
    Abstract: The combination of a pair of aligned tubular membes joined together in end-to-end relationship, where the tubular members are joined by an internal expansion coupling device. The combination is designed for applications exposed to high operating temperatures and pressures. The combination comprises a tubular member characterized by a flared end portion having a diameter exceeding the diameter of the tubular members. Additionally, there is provided an internal expansion coupling device formed of an elongated open ended tubular joint member consisting of a relatively rigid sheet-like member, where the sheet ends overlap such that the end portions lie essentially contiguous with each other. A compressive seal member is provided between said end portions, and a flexible O-ring type member formed of a high temperature resistant material, is disposed within said flared end portion in contact with the relatively rigid sheet-like member.

  • Patent number: 4927189
    Abstract: This invention relates to an internal expansion coupling, having particular utility in joining together two tubular members or pipes aligned in end-to-end relationship. The device hereof comprises(a) an elongated open ended tubular joint member formed of a relatively rigid sheet-like member, where the sheet ends overlap such that the end portions lie contiguous with each other;(b) a continuous sleeve formed of an elastomeric material and overlapping the sheet side about at least one open end of said tubular joint member, where said sleeve, about the circumference thereof, is provided with at least one continuous upstanding rib which is adapted to lie adjacent to and be compressed against the inside wall of a tubular member; and(c) means for expanding said sheet-like member whereby said sheet ends move circumferentially towards one another urging said elastomeric sleeve and said rib against the inside wall of a tubular member.
